Introduction to Guelph - City Centre
Guelph is a Canadian city in the southwest of Ontario, less than an hour's drive from Toronto. It is considered to be one of the most liveable places in Canada, courtesy of its fantastic architecture, vibrant festivals and numerous cultural venues. Travellers can reach Guelph City Centre hotels by driving here on Highway 401, and then taking exit 295 for the Hanlon Expressway. Alternatively, VIA Rail operates regular trains from Toronto, taking just over an hour. Those interested in seeing some of the city's best architecture should visit the Church of Our Lady on Norfolk Street. This limestone church was built in 1877, incorporating a Gothic-revival style and overlooking the city. Another fine example of limestone architecture is McCrae House, the birthplace of John McCrae, situated on the south side of the Speed River. This small cottage is now a National Historic Site and tells the story of this famous author's life. No visitor should miss seeing the wooden pedestrian bridge across the Speed River.
